顯示廣告
隱藏 ✕
※ 本文為 applejone.bbs. 轉寄自 ptt.cc 更新時間: 2013-10-04 16:18:54
看板 PC_Shopping
作者 TWN48 (台灣48)
標題 Re: [菜單] 80K工作站
時間 Thu Oct  3 02:22:14 2013


: → kagasun     :CUDA才建議使用NV,可以辜狗 "NVIDIA,F**k You"      10/01 17:54
這裡應該有些誤解。

(以下 "Nvidia" 指的是公司,"nvidia" 指的是特定的 driver 名字)

在 Linux 的 X Window 世界裡,Nvidia 的顯示卡 driver 主要有三個選擇:

(1) nv
    這是最早的 open source 版本,Nvidia 曾經提供支援,但是從 2010 之後就停
    止支援新卡和一些新功能。

(2) nvidia
    這是 Nvidia 放出來的 proprietary 版本(沒有 source),功能、穩定性算是
    還不錯。

(3) nouveau
    這是在缺乏文件的情況下對 nvidia driver 做逆向工程寫出來的 open source
    版本,勉強算可以用,但在一些特殊情況的穩定性不如 nvidia。另外在 power
    management 之類的能力也比不上 nvidia。(沒有支援又沒有文件,沒辦法)

(隨著時間演進,情況可能稍微有變,但趨勢大致是如此)


簡單說,Nvidia 在停止對 nv 的支援之後只放出 nvidia,但 proprietary driver
就只是個黑盒子,在 license、安全性等很多方面都會有諸多顧慮,而且在更新頻率、
與整合方面也完全受制於 Nvidia,社群顯然希望也能有個 open source 的版本。

但是在之前一段時間 Nvidia 就一直採取不願意合作的態度——既不願直接支援
nv / nouveau 的開發,也不願提供技術文件(所以社群只好用逆向工程硬幹),因
此才會有 Linus 大大公開對 Nvidia 比中指的事件。


直到最近,這件事稍微有點轉機:
http://goo.gl/CdGuDP
Nvidia seeks peace with Linux, pledges help on open source driver (Updated) | Ars Technica
[圖]
Torvalds isn't yet ready to apologize for giving Nvidia the finger. ...
 

前一陣子 Nvidia 改變態度,承諾會開始逐漸提供技術文件,好讓 open source 版
的 driver 開發能更順利。當然這件事還沒完全發生,要等到 nouveau 像 nvidia
一樣好用可能還要一段時間……



===== 想 END 的人的分隔線 =====


但是如果你只是插了一張 Nvidia 的顯示卡,想要 Linux / X Window 能正常工作、
有基本的 2D / 3D 能力等等,並不是很在意 driver 是 proprietary 或 open
source 的,那就直接用 Nvidia 官方的 proprietary driver(nvidia) 就好。

根據外國鄉民的心得,同樣是 Linux / X Window 上的 proprietary driver,N 社
的比 A 社的好用、穩定多了。


--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 140.112.30.32
s25g5d4     :聽說最穩定的其實是intel1F 10/03 02:57
GhostAI     :知識推XD2F 10/03 03:08
abcdef56    :Intel HD2000有曾經完全找不到驅動 連1080p都無法顯3F 10/03 04:16
abcdef56    :示
cowbaying   :INTEL要更新X WINDOWS才抓得到最新的驅動5F 10/03 08:59
cowbaying   :所以灌好LINUX的第一件事就是更新系統

--
※ 同主題文章:
※ 看板: PC_Shopping 文章推薦值: 0 目前人氣: 0 累積人氣: 616 
分享網址: 複製 已複製
guest
x)推文 r)回覆 e)編輯 d)刪除 M)收藏 ^x)轉錄 同主題: =)首篇 [)上篇 ])下篇